Through their inventive and vibrant works, the artists in this exhibition reveal the diverse points of view and artistic styles found in the world of Native printmaking today. This show is traveled by Exhibit Envoy and is supplemented at the Grace Hudson Museum with works by California Indian printmakers.

Image: Radiant Owl by Kenojuak Ashevak

Several special events will take place during the exhibit’s course, including an illustrated lecture by scholar Brian Bibby on the life and art of Harry Fonseca, Nisenan Maidu, on February 15; a Native flute concert on Friday, March 6, as part of First Friday Art Walk; and an illustrated talk by Professor Leslie Saxon West on Native printmaking traditions in Arctic Canada on April 18.
